// Context for the 4.2.1 hotfix client setup (query planner regression).
// After the Larkstone 4.2 upgrade, the planner started choosing a full
// scan on the metrics rollup path, inflating p99 latency roughly sixfold.
// This client pins the planner hint flag until the fix lands in 4.2.2,
// so do not remove the hint block during release prep. The client
// authenticates against the internal Plannerscope diagnostics service,
// which requires its own credential. The key it expects is the one
// directly below this comment.

service key, fawip-bajef: kto11_Qt5wZK9vdNC

Subject: Welcome — quick note on the tax cache

Hey, welcome aboard! Since you're covering on-call this week, here's the one thing that'll probably page you: the tax-rate lookup cache in Ledgerbird. It refreshes from the Ravena rates feed every six hours, and when the feed hiccups we serve stale rates (by design — don't panic). Only escalate if staleness exceeds 24 hours. Flushing the cache manually is almost never the right move. The refresh procedure and staleness thresholds are documented on the internal page below.

wiki page, yaguf-bawig: https://jira.norvacorp.internal/browse/display/view/b5a061abb09d

## Changelog — GiftNote Mailer v2.4

Heads up, support crew: we renamed `RECEIPT_KEY` to `GIFTNOTE_MAILER_SECRET` because folks kept confusing it with the PDF template key. Old name still works until next month, then it's gone for real. If a donor reports missing receipts, check the env first. Your local env file should include the new line right here:

sealed setting: ARCHIVE_KEY3=8d0